City Guide
California, Santander, Colombia
Overview
California, Santander is a picturesque small mountain town known for its colonial architecture, gold-mining history, and proximity to lush Andean landscapes. With under 2,000 residents, it's a peaceful destination for travelers seeking authentic local culture and outdoor adventure.
Best Time to Visit
June to August for mild temperatures and minimal rainfall
Local Tips
Bring cash, as ATMs and card payments are rare; wear comfortable shoes for walking on cobblestone streets; pack layers as the weather changes rapidly in the mountains.
Cultural Etiquette
Tipping is customary (5-10% in restaurants); dress modestly, especially near churches; always greet locals with a polite 'buenos días' or 'buenas tardes.'
Safety Warnings
Petty crime is rare, but keep an eye on belongings in busy areas; avoid hiking outside town after dark due to limited lighting and wildlife.
Hidden Gems
Explore the old gold mines with a guide, visit the locally run artisan chocolate workshop, and hike to the Mirador de la Virgen for sweeping valley views.
